Output 3088465ce95b2bcbb2e50524b4e6a1815f0f9c81360a6f9fceddd07f03dfbcc2:0

value
58675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e927deaa14dc17b3d2df5819d8786a6c15f19d9c OP_EQUAL
address
3Nwq8SYpk4yfTYXjHrZuw754KhXXUZeiQu
transaction
3088465ce95b2bcbb2e50524b4e6a1815f0f9c81360a6f9fceddd07f03dfbcc2
confirmations
268944
spent
true